Building a captivating online presence needs more than just a visually appealing design. It's about crafting immersive experiences that engage users on an emotional level. This involves leveraging a diverse suite of digital tools and techniques to transform static web pages into interactive, dynamic platforms. From prototyping and wireframing to coding and content creation, the modern web designer employs a vast arsenal at their disposal.
- Coding Languages: Mastering languages like HTML, CSS, and JavaScript is fundamental to bringing designs to life.
- Design Software: Tools like Adobe Photoshop and Illustrator provide the canvas for crafting visually stunning graphics and user interfaces.
- Prototyping Platforms: InVision and Figma allow designers to create interactive prototypes, simulating the user experience before development begins.
By combining these elements, web designers can develop compelling digital experiences that captivate audiences, build engagement, and ultimately achieve desired business outcomes.

From Pixels to Programs
The realm of software development is a fascinating fusion of creativity and technical prowess. While designers craft the user experience with meticulous attention to detail, developers bring those visions to life through code.
Harmoniously bridging this gap between pixels and programs necessitates a deep understanding of both disciplines.
A strong collaboration between designers and developers is crucial for building intuitive and engaging software applications. This collaborative process involves open communication, shared goals, and here a willingness to learn from each other's expertise. Designers can benefit from learning about the technical constraints and possibilities of development, while developers can gain valuable insights into user needs and expectations.
Consequently, this symbiotic relationship results in software that is not only functional but also aesthetically pleasing and user-friendly.
